Concentration of?dilute lime slurry desulfurization agent.The desulfurization technology had the desulfurization rate,flue gas handling large amount of sorbent utilization, pollution, simple operation and maintenance advantages. This technology was still at an experimental stage, had not been applied to industrial production. Particularly suitable for small and medium-sized coal-fired boiler flue gas desulfurization. For experimental research and teaching presentations designed a spray spouted bedsemi-dry flue gas desulfurization experimental device The device by the spouted bed, heater, cyclone, baghouse, slurry tanks and ancillary equipment The device could be tested?in this experiment the intake air temperature, gas flow, spoutedbed height, Ca/S ratio and other factors on the desulfurization efficiency, and could do the flue gas desulfurization demonstration experiments.
